DON'T STOP BELIEVIN' Don't Stop Believin' was the dream that the Class of '83 had in mind for the 81-82 prom. Much time and hard work was needed to make this dream come true on May 8, 1982. We started preparing in the summer of '81 by renting the K of C Hall and arranging for the band Get Away. Many hours were devoted to raising money in order to put on a memora- ble prom. We started by selling London's Candy bars and collecting class dues our Sophomore year. In our Junior year, we collected class dues, sold candy, and money was donated by the '82 Seniors. Finally, through a benefit concert put on by the rock band. Free Fare, we collect- ed sufficient funds. Most people dream to find a pot of gold at the end of a rainbow. That was the reason why rainbows were the perfect decor to fulfill our plans to make our dream come true. The hall was decorated in six hours of hard work and fun Everything from crepe paper to a 6-foot lighted rainbow was used. Thanks to the great ideas of Mr. Paul and Mrs. Breen, we even had a turning ball to add the finishing touch to the dance floor. All in all, we felt that the prom was a great success. We tried our best to tell everyone who attended Don't Stop Believin' because your dreams can come true. By Dennette Duff and Stacey Schaub Prom 13
